So I fully intended this entry to ponder the Gilmore Girls spin off that never was: Windward Circle AKA Jess’ adventures in Los Angeles.
Gilmore Girls Season 3 episode 21 ‘Here Comes The Son’ was a backdoor pilot episode in which Jess meets some west-coast youngsters who look like Hansen, talk like Shakespeare and half-inch his book – the rascals!
